Why Friendly, Non-Judgmental UI Matters
Understanding the Context
A friendly, non-judgmental UI puts real people at the center. It means designing with empathy—avoiding overly technical jargon, ambiguous labels, or confusing interactions that leave users guessing. Instead, intuitive navigation, clear feedback, and consistent patterns foster a welcoming experience that empowers everyone, from first-time users to seasoned experts.
This approach isn’t just kind—it’s effective. Studies show that interfaces built with user clarity improve engagement, reduce support tickets, and boost long-term satisfaction. So let’s explore how you can design confidently with verified expertise and clear contributor profiles.
The Power of Expert Verification Badges
When users see verified contributor profiles—complete with expert badges, verified roles, or endorsements—they instantly recognize credibility. These badges act as trusted signals that the design team or contributor has proven domain knowledge.

Implementing expert verification badges on your platform:
- Boosts trust: Users feel secure knowing the work reflects real expertise.
- Encourages accountability: Contributors are motivated to uphold quality standards.
- Differentiates quality: In competitive spaces, verified roles stand out and build lasting credibility.
How to Display Roles & Expertise Clearly
Visibility breeds confidence. Here’s how to showcase contributor roles effectively:
- Use clear, concise titles linked to verified credentials.
- Integrate badges—like “UX Specialist,” “Certified UI Designer,” or “Industry-Vetted”—near profiles or contributor headings.
- Include certification links or short verifications directly in user cards.
- Update roles dynamically to reflect ongoing learning and growth.
By combining clear labeling with transparent expertise, you invite users to engage with trust.
